Output 3052663f8649003182dac3d6fe73da585b5d6d2105be663152a7542947c28b66:2
- value
- 5190176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8ebba4d39d285ef05a1ba04072d202dfef9490e OP_EQUAL
- address
- 3H6BqRRKAET7gyLj1hFNDR2u9JgYfus9Zw
- transaction
- 3052663f8649003182dac3d6fe73da585b5d6d2105be663152a7542947c28b66
- spent
- true